Education Outreach Program Coordinator
Syracuse University is a private, international research university with a rich history and diverse academic offerings. The Education Outreach Program Coordinator will provide critical support for educational engagement and outreach activities, coordinating programs and enhancing community relations through strategic planning and collaboration with local schools and community organizations.
Responsibilities
Enhancing and modifying programs Community Folk Art Center (CFAC). Planning and implementation of educational programs focused on but not restricted to: increasing exhibitions, film screenings, gallery talks, workshops and courses in the studio, the Creative Arts Academy (CAA), performing and expressive arts for CFAC and engaging youth and University audiences
Executing assigned education and outreach planning goals from CFAC Executive Director, enhancing plans and projects for best results
Assembling project teams with CFAC, community partners (incl. local schools, libraries, youth programs); coordinating meetings; assisting with goal creation, outcomes, and next steps
Coordinating advertising and marketing materials in collaboration with CFAC’s marketing outreach coordinator
Recruiting programs, negotiating terms, scheduling events, and managing registration for events
Providing onsite assistance and ensuring that education materials are provided to supplement artistic exhibitions, catalogues, dramaturgical notes for performances, and providing excellent research to support those activities
Manage, coordinate and enhance educational activities connecting CFAC and other special initiatives such as SU Wellness, public libraries, and education directors at regional arts/cultural centers to Syracuse University academics; increasing University student attendance, and support institutional strategic plans
Planning of educational and performance activities in advance of the next fiscal year
Coordinating team meetings, assisting with goal creation, tracking of outcomes and next steps
Support arts engagement and audience development
Designing and implementing public and community educational programs such as lectures, symposia, etc
Track the effectiveness of outreach efforts and program participation. Provide regular reports and feedback to CFAC leadership on outreach outcomes and community impact
Updating and implementing CFAC collections management procedures including online database
Assist in identifying potential donors and sponsors. Support fundraising initiatives through outreach efforts and community engagement
Identifying areas of collaboration with community-based arts organizations and with the schools and colleges at Syracuse University
Implement policies and procedures to achieve programming goals set by the Executive Director
Assist in supervision of student employees and a limited number of temporary employees
